Bible Verses Talking About Healing

Healing is one of the most comforting and hope-filled themes found in the Bible. Whether you’re facing physical illness, emotional pain, spiritual struggles, or heartbreak, Scripture offers powerful words of restoration and peace. Throughout both the Old and New Testaments, God reveals Himself as a healer—one who restores bodies, renews minds, and revives weary souls.

In this post, we’ll explore Bible verses about healing, what they mean, and how they can encourage you in times of need. If you're searching for comfort, strength, or reassurance, these scriptures can serve as anchors of hope.


God Is Our Healer

From the very beginning, God reveals His healing nature. One of His names in the Bible is Jehovah Rapha, which means “The Lord who heals.”

📖 Exodus 15:26

“For I am the Lord who heals you.”

This verse reminds us that healing is part of God’s character. He is not distant from our pain; He actively works to restore and renew.

📖 Psalm 103:2–3

“Praise the Lord, my soul, and forget not all his benefits—who forgives all your sins and heals all your diseases.”

Here, David connects forgiveness and healing. This shows that healing in the Bible isn’t only physical—it also includes spiritual restoration.

Key Takeaway:

  • God’s healing power covers body, mind, and spirit.
  • Healing flows from His love and mercy.
  • Trust in His character even when healing takes time.

Bible Verses About Physical Healing

The Bible contains numerous accounts of physical healing. These stories demonstrate God’s compassion and power.

📖 Jeremiah 30:17

“But I will restore you to health and heal your wounds,’ declares the Lord.”

God speaks directly about restoration. Even when people felt abandoned or broken, He promised renewal.

📖 Isaiah 53:5

“By his wounds we are healed.”

This prophetic verse points to Jesus. Christians believe that through Christ’s suffering, spiritual healing became available to all.

📖 James 5:14–15

“Is anyone among you sick? Let them call the elders of the church to pray over them…”

This passage emphasizes:

  • The power of prayer
  • Community support
  • Faith in God’s ability to heal

Healing for Emotional and Broken Hearts

Healing isn’t limited to physical illness. Many people struggle with emotional wounds, grief, anxiety, and depression. The Bible speaks directly to those hurting hearts.

📖 Psalm 147:3

“He heals the brokenhearted and binds up their wounds.”

This beautiful imagery shows God as a compassionate caregiver, tending to emotional pain gently and personally.

📖 Matthew 11:28

“Come to me, all you who are weary and burdened, and I will give you rest.”

Jesus invites the exhausted and overwhelmed to find rest in Him. Emotional healing often begins with surrender.

If you’re emotionally hurting:

  • Spend time in prayer.
  • Meditate on healing scriptures.
  • Surround yourself with supportive, faith-filled people.
  • Seek professional help when needed—God often works through wise counsel.

Spiritual Healing and Restoration

Spiritual healing is one of the deepest forms of restoration mentioned in Scripture. Sin separates humanity from God, but His grace restores that relationship.

📖 2 Chronicles 7:14

“If my people, who are called by my name, will humble themselves and pray… then I will hear from heaven… and will heal their land.”

This verse highlights:

  • Humility
  • Prayer
  • Turning away from wrongdoing
  • Divine restoration

📖 1 Peter 2:24

“He himself bore our sins in his body on the cross… by his wounds you have been healed.”

Spiritual healing brings:

  • Forgiveness
  • Freedom from guilt
  • Renewed purpose
  • Peace with God

The Healing Ministry of Jesus

A major part of Jesus’ earthly ministry involved healing the sick, blind, lame, and oppressed. His actions demonstrated both divine authority and deep compassion.

Some examples include:

  • The Blind Man (John 9:1-7) – Jesus restores sight.
  • The Woman with the Issue of Blood (Mark 5:34) – Faith brings healing.
  • The Paralyzed Man (Mark 2:1-12) – Jesus heals both body and soul.

These accounts show that:

  • Jesus sees individual needs.
  • Faith plays a powerful role.
  • Healing is both physical and spiritual.
  • Compassion is central to God’s heart.

How to Apply Bible Verses About Healing in Your Life

Reading Bible verses about healing is powerful, but applying them makes transformation possible.

Here are practical steps:

Pray specifically – Bring your needs honestly before God.
Declare Scripture – Speak healing verses over your life.
Trust God’s timing – Healing may be immediate or gradual.
Remain hopeful – God’s answers sometimes look different than expected.
Stay connected to a faith community – Support matters.

Remember: God’s ultimate healing includes eternal restoration, not just temporary relief.
